QMX T507 woes
When I first built my QMX, it had zero RF output and the RX could only barely hear the strongest signals. Mike/w1mt suggested I remove T507, bypassing it across its C-C connection and see what?happened. That completely fixed my problem. And since SWR checking had not been implemented yet (that's what T507 is for), I then operated the QMX successfully on CW and FT8 for several weeks without T507. When Hans posted that he had gotten SWR functionality working on his development platform a few days ago, I decided to revisit T507. To make a long story short, I was back to no RF output and essentially no receive. I sent some pix of my board to Mike/w1mt and he immediately spotted my problem. I had done the single turn windings wrong (see attached photo). The instructions say to pass these single turn windings through "each" hole once. You can see how I interpreted that in the photo. I built T507 three times like this, never considering that that was wrong. What Mike pointed out was that these windings are straight pieces of wire going through a single hole each. Making that change got my QMX going 100%! Of course I studied the photos in the assembly manual carefully, but I somehow subconsiously convinced myself that my interpretation was consistent with them, without ever questioning it. I thought the loops in my implementation were either not visible, or omitted for clarity - how ironic! Apologies for this long post. I am slightly red-faced about my mistake and the hours spent not seeing it, but it might help someone else If the manually were updated to point out this possible misinterpretation. Loving my QMX now! 73, Randy, KS4L? |

The T/R switch, Q508, switches open during transmit, protecting the receiver circuitry. JZ On Mon, Sep 25, 2023, 11:17 AM Randy <wrmoore47@...> wrote:
